Here’s the Truth About Home Prices
Despite recent global upsets, your home is still worth more than before.
Are you worried about the value of your home? If so, you’re not alone. It’s true that home prices have dipped down from their peak two years ago, but context is key when considering the state of the housing market.
Since the start of the pandemic, there have been changes in home prices. According to recent data, nationally, home values have dropped by 2.8% since June of last year. However, it’s important to take a look at the bigger picture. Home values increased by 39.7% over the two years prior, which puts the recent change in perspective.
If you’re concerned about home price declines, know that you likely haven’t lost all the value gained over time. It’s important not to let national headlines about the value of homes worry or mislead you. The odds are the value of your home is probably up from where it was a few years back.
